Gene
DAQ1742_04263  ilvA; Threonine dehydratase biosynthetic [KO:K01754] [EC:4.3.1.19]
DAQ1742_03425  L-serine dehydratase, (PLP)-dependent @ Threonine dehydratase biosynthetic [KO:K17989] [EC:4.3.1.17 4.3.1.19]
DAQ1742_03837  leuC; 3-isopropylmalate dehydratase large subunit [KO:K01703] [EC:4.2.1.33 4.2.1.35]
DAQ1742_03838  leuD; 3-isopropylmalate dehydratase small subunit [KO:K01704] [EC:4.2.1.33 4.2.1.35]
DAQ1742_03836  leuB; 3-isopropylmalate dehydrogenase [KO:K00052] [EC:1.1.1.85]
DAQ1742_03832  ilvI; Acetolactate synthase large subunit [KO:K01652] [EC:2.2.1.6]
DAQ1742_03849  ilvB; Acetolactate synthase large subunit [KO:K01652] [EC:2.2.1.6]
DAQ1742_04267  ilvG; Acetolactate synthase large subunit [KO:K01652] [EC:2.2.1.6]
DAQ1742_00733  budB; Acetolactate synthase, catabolic [KO:K01652] [EC:2.2.1.6]
DAQ1742_03831  ilvH; Acetolactate synthase small subunit [KO:K01653] [EC:2.2.1.6]
DAQ1742_03850  ilvN; Acetolactate synthase small subunit [KO:K01653] [EC:2.2.1.6]
DAQ1742_04266  ilvM; Acetolactate synthase small subunit [KO:K11258] [EC:2.2.1.6]
DAQ1742_04259  ilvC; Ketol-acid reductoisomerase [KO:K00053] [EC:1.1.1.86]
DAQ1742_04264  ilvD; Dihydroxy-acid dehydratase [KO:K01687] [EC:4.2.1.9]
DAQ1742_02416  Branched-chain amino acid aminotransferase [KO:K00826] [EC:2.6.1.42]
DAQ1742_04265  ilvE; Branched-chain amino acid aminotransferase [KO:K00826] [EC:2.6.1.42]
DAQ1742_04380  avtA; Valine--pyruvate aminotransferase [KO:K00835] [EC:2.6.1.66]
DAQ1742_01351  alaA; Aspartate aminotransferase [KO:K14260] [EC:2.6.1.66 2.6.1.2]
DAQ1742_03835  leuA; 2-isopropylmalate synthase [KO:K01649] [EC:2.3.3.13]
